Skip to content

IP-7154: [compose] 배포 CI/CD 최신화#548

Merged
novdov merged 3 commits intomainfrom
ip-7154
Mar 19, 2026
Merged

IP-7154: [compose] 배포 CI/CD 최신화#548
novdov merged 3 commits intomainfrom
ip-7154

Conversation

@novdov
Copy link
Copy Markdown
Contributor

@novdov novdov commented Mar 19, 2026

목적

배포 및 테스트 워크플로의 GitHub Actions 버전을 최신화하고, 불필요한 스킬을 정리

변경 사항

  • 워크플로 액션 버전 최신화
    • actions/checkout v4 → v6
    • astral-sh/setup-uv v5 → v7
    • actions/setup-python v5 → v6
    • uv 버전 0.9.26 → 0.10.11
  • 배포 워크플로 개선
    • job 이름 publish-packagepublish로 간결화
    • workflow_dispatch 트리거 들여쓰기 오류 수정
  • 불필요해진 release-compose 스킬 제거

@novdov novdov self-assigned this Mar 19, 2026
@linear
Copy link
Copy Markdown

linear bot commented Mar 19, 2026

IP-7154 [compose] 배포 CI/CD 최신화

배경

  • 배포 워크플로 파일명이 기능을 명확히 반영하지 않음
  • 워크플로에서 사용하는 GitHub Actions 버전이 최신이 아님
  • release 스킬 개선으로 release-compose 스킬이 불필요해짐

목표

  • 워크플로 파일명을 publish.yml로 변경하여 용도를 명확히 함
  • 사용 중인 액션을 최신 버전으로 업데이트
  • 불필요한 release-compose 스킬 제거

@pozalabs-workspace pozalabs-workspace bot added the Improvement New feature or request label Mar 19, 2026
@novdov novdov merged commit b3e8bc0 into main Mar 19, 2026
4 checks passed
@novdov novdov deleted the ip-7154 branch March 19, 2026 02: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Improvement New feature or request

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ant